one last diff swap question-driveshaft removal

hi there,

am planning my diff swap this friday/saturday on my uk 190e 2.5 16v. i have searched for this info but cant find the precise answers i need.

i am pretty happy with everything apart from removal of the driveshafts, looking at the replacement diff i have i cant see how the driveshafts are attached to the diff-there doesnt seem to be any fixing hols around the perimiter of the driveshaft "holes"

the diff has asd/lsd/abs if this makes any difference

could someone talk me through the procudure of remving the driveshafts from the car and highlight any specific tools i may need.....last thing i want is to pull the car apart to find i need extra tools!
